Key Factors Affecting UPS Prices in Guatemala
UPS costs vary significantly based on technical specifications and local market conditions. Here's what shapes pricing:
- Power Capacity: Entry-level models (500-800VA) start at Q800-1,200 ($100-150), while commercial systems (5-10kVA) range from Q15,000-45,000 ($2,000-6,000)
- Battery Type: Lead-acid units cost 30-40% less than lithium-ion alternatives
- Import Taxes: Guatemala's 12% VAT and 5-15% customs duties impact final pricing
2024 Market Price Comparison
Capacity | Entry-Level (Q) | Mid-Range (Q) | Commercial (Q) |
---|---|---|---|
500-800VA | 800-1,200 | 1,500-2,800 | - |
1-3kVA | 2,000-4,500 | 5,000-8,000 | 10,000-18,000 |
Why Guatemala Needs Reliable Power Solutions
Frequent voltage fluctuations and an average of 8.7 monthly outages (2023 National Electrification Commission data) make UPS systems essential for:
- Protecting medical equipment in hospitals
- Maintaining operations in call centers
- Preserving food storage in supermarkets

Smart Purchasing Tips
Cut through the noise with these practical suggestions:
- Calculate your total wattage needs + 25% buffer
- Compare local vs. international brands - local support matters!
- Ask about warranty extensions (typically 1-3 years)

Frequently Asked Questions
- Q: How often should I replace UPS batteries?A: Every 3-5 years, depending on usage and climate conditions
- Q: Can UPS systems handle Guatemala's voltage spikes?A: Quality units with AVR technology stabilize voltages between 90-140V
